Introduction
- Course introduction - Review of Calculus - The Role of ODE in Engineering Problem Solving - The simplest ODE, and review of complex exponential function, Taylor’s series - Basic Concept of Differential Equations

First-order differential equations
-Separate ODE -Exact ODE -Linear ODE - Modeling Examples -Existence and Uniqueness

Linear Differential Equations of Second and Higher order
-Theory of Linear ODE -Constant-coefficient Linear Homogeneous ODE -Reduction of Order -Euler Cauchy Linear Homogeneous ODE -Modeling Examples - Linear Non-homogeneous ODE -Modeling Examples

System of Differential Equations
- System of linear ODE - Homogeneous system with constant coefficients - Non-homogeneous system

Laplace Transformation
-Definition of Laplace transform -Properties of Laplace transform - Differential equations – Laplace transform -Partial fractions -System of differential equations
